The Brand Management function is responsible for ensuring that Hilton's global brands are compelling to owners and guests in the region. This means shaping Hilton's lifestyle brands in ways that resonate with diverse regional markets, while keeping true to global positioning. The broader APAC Brands team includes a range of other functions, including ensuring hotels open on time, comply with brand standards, and have the tools to consistently deliver industry-leading guest experiences.
Hilton's Lifestyle brands include Canopy by Hilton, Motto by Hilton, Curio Collection by Hilton, and Tapestry Collection by Hilton. These brands celebrate creativity, modern culture, and individuality, attracting a new generation of travelers who seek hotels that enable them to express themselves. The Director, Lifestyle Brand Management - APAC will be a passionate and results-driven brand leader who thrives on connecting global strategy with regional context. This role requires not only creativity and analysis, but also the ability to understand the essence of Lifestyle and translate what is often intangible into clear direction for teams across diverse cultures.

+ Adapt Hilton's global Lifestyle brands to owners and guests in the APAC region, balancing global consistency with regional relevance.
+ Distill the intangible aspects of Lifestyle, such as design ethos, service style, and cultural energy, into clear and practical guidance that hotel and corporate teams across different cultures can understand and implement.
+ Review hotel deals for brand fit, providing recommendations and approvals that align with both owner return and brand positioning.
+ Identify and close capability gaps in how Lifestyle hotels operate; design and implement tools, training, and processes to address them.
+ Partner with Hilton's global Lifestyle design, F&B, and marketing teams to ensure best-in-class capabilities are deployed in APAC.
+ Review hotel design, F&B, and market positioning, giving clear feedback and guidance to ensure accurate execution.
+ Develop strategies to drive greater owner preference, consumer awareness, and guest preference for Hilton Lifestyle brands and hotels in APAC.
+ Engage across diverse APAC markets by visiting hotels, monitoring competitive landscapes, and adapting approaches to different cultural contexts.
+ Build strong relationships with internal and external stakeholders, navigating complex conversations in a heavily matrixed environment.
